%X Wireless mobile ad hoc networks are infrastructure networks where nodes move repeatedly, which causes a change in topology. So, routing is important for mobile networks. When a route is destroyed, the path search must be performed. This operation requires more energy and increases the end-to-end delay. In this paper, a new algorithm by which multiple paths are established using fuzzy logic is proposed. Priority is a defining factor to select a path. The proposed algorithm increases package delivery and decreases the end-to-end delay.
